Tesseract and Beyond: Exploring Higher Dimensional Spaces

The concept of dimensionality encompasses beyond our everyday perception of three spatial dimensions. While we navigate a world defined by length, width, and height, mathematicians and physicists venture into realms of four or even higher dimensions. The tesseract, a four-dimensional cube, serves as a intriguing example of this, offering glimpses into extraordinary spatial configurations.

Visualizing these higher dimensions yields a significant challenge, as our brains are designed to process only three. Yet, theoretical models and simulations help us to understand the complexities of these multidimensional spaces.
